I own a 2015 Genesis 35k miles (bought it new and posted here before).

I have owned many Hyundai Models (SantFe (2), Azera, Genesis) and Kia Sorento.

The Genesis has had some really hazardous issues the dealer cannot figure out.

1. At a stop, turning left. Press on the gas while turning the wheel left the car stalls. Try that in heavy taffic
2. On the highway, need to change lanes quick, turn the wheel, hit the gas, crap! here comes a MAC Truck and the car stalled
3. On a curve (going left) and the road curves back the right the wheel STICKS! You have to yank it back
4. The driver seat if you recline it, it will not come back up all the way (6 repair attempts, they admitted they have no idea) so they keep resetting it.
5. Turning signal bulbs burn out once a month
6. Foul smell after the A/C runs during the summer.

All of these items I have brought the car to the dealer many times. Total time in the shop since 2015: 45 Days.
 
You should investigate the lemon laws for the state you live in.
 
Go to the dealer you are working with and demand (nicely) to see the owner of the dealership.
Tell your story about the cutting off in traffic and the steering sticking. They are safety issues.
Things will start happening.

Im curious. Have you had any issues with the steering pulling the car to the right? I find that my 2016 is really starting to pull yet I just had an alignment done and the tires were re balance twice now.
 
Im curious. Have you had any issues with the steering pulling the car to the right? I find that my 2016 is really starting to pull yet I just had an alignment done and the tires were re balance twice now.
Once tires are worn in an irregular manner, realignment will not usually help. You will have to do an alignment immediately after buying new tires.

I would avoid an alignment done by the spces only (typical of a dealer). I got my Genesis aligned years ago after new tires, and they first did the specs, and then did 3 test drives, adjusting the alignment after each test drive. Car has driven straight even since then. I used a suspension shop recommended by my local Costco Tire shop.
 
The driver's seat is the position limit sensor. I have had trouble with it. I had mine adjusted several times and then parts replaced. It is working fine now.
 
I have a '16 3.8 HTRAC that also sticks when turning left. There's another thread about this on the forum, but unfortunately, there appears to be no fix. Sometimes, it's really severe, and if you aren't paying close attention, it will drive the car off the road. I've had the dealer look at it several times, athey keep telling me that they can't repeat the problem. Other drivers of my car have also experienced the issue, so I know I'm not imagining it, and posts like yours validate that the issue does happen with other Genesis owners. So far, the dealer has reset the steering twice, done an alignment and sold me a set of new tires (with another alignment), but the issue continues. Aside from this clearly dangerous problem, the steering is pretty awful. In highway driving, the play is so great that it requires constant adjustment. Since this is apparently un-fixable, I am looking to dump this car for something that is actually enjoyable and safe to drive.
